Not sure if this is known yet or not, but just in case I'll post it here.
To use this, you would need to die out of bounds and be revived from a fairy, and upon entering back in bounds, the cutscene that would normally play when dying/reviving gets delayed while out of bounds and will start to proceed when entering back in bounds.
Just a couple of seconds before the cutscene from being revived ends, you would then open a door and it will cancel your animation and you can regain control over link, just like you would do with the dins fire strat.
Opening the door way too early will not work because Link will proceed to opening the door and the glitch will not work.
Idk if this can have that much use to it since it would be hard to find areas where you can die and revive out of bounds to delay the cutscene for it, but I think it might be worth looking into for it, right off the bat, I only know areas with water and crawlspaces can work at the moment, hopefully there are other ways to perform this in other areas and have use from it.

This video is showing off everything that Dark Link can do similar to what Link can do in The Legend of Zelda Ocarina of Time.
This is known by a lot of people and in the Ocarina of Time Community, but for those who don't know or not aware, Dark Link was originally copied from Link, so they share a lot of mechanics together, but with a few modifications here and there, this is why a lot of stuff in the video that were done is possible.
Also, whatever age you are, you share that age with Dark Link as well.
Other things I tested but Dark Link couldn't do:
He can't reflect objects with his Shield (including light with the Mirror Shield).
He can't activate rusted switches or remove Fire Temple blocks with the Megaton Hammer, he can destroy Ganondorf's platforms with the Megaton Hammer though.
He can't void out by jumping into a void.
He can't enter loading zones.
I couldn't get him to do the dying animation (the same one that Link does)
He can't activate cutscenes, that includes by walking past a trigger or using an Ocarina to do it.
He can't remove Time Blocks with the Ocarina.
He can't grab Items, except a Golden Skulltula Token (even underwater items while diving).
He can't activate Blue Warps.
He can't do direct attacks on other enemies with a Sword or Sword like item. He can cause certain enemies to die or get stunned using another item, which I showcase at some point in the video.

Been working on a compilation video for weeks of everything Dark Link and Link share mechanically together.
However, Hylian Freddy mentioned that performing the Shield Swipe Method can counter the restricted mode.
The way the Shield Swipe Tech works is you:
1. Hold Z Target
2. Then Hold Shield while still holding Z Target
3. Continue holding Z and R, and whatever Item Link is holding while in the water, whichever button that item is assigned to, you hold that.
4. Release Z and Shield, but do not let go of the Item you are using and it will allow you to use the item.
Any Items that Link can not hold (Din's Fire, Magic Beans, etc.) and any Items that require Magic (Fire Arrows, Lens of Truth etc.) will not work at this current time.

Supposedly there is a specific floor property in the game that allows Link to be able to hover up in the air which is very weird, same floor property that Chamber of Sages has (only specifically to do with the water floor).
As far as I know of, Chamber of Sages is the only area that has this.
In this video, I hacked in the floor property in Lake Hylia, Lake Hylia does NOT actually have this property, it was hacked in.
The Raw Data Value used in both this video and in Chamber of Sages:
0x1C000000000027C4
The "1C" is value in this is what allows Link to do this.
For now this is useless since it's in Chamber of Sages and there isn't really much in here and even if there is, you can't really gain control over Link without cheats in this area, so here it is just in case it can lead something one day (which i doubt lol).
(Edit after Upload): I experimented with it some more, and apparently for some weird reason, you can only do the hover if you're above the water, if you're above the Medallions/Triforce Platforms, you can't hover, I even used the L to Levitate cheat, when i'm on the platforms I can fly as high as I want, but when i'm above the water, Link only gets very little distance off the ground and he can't fall back down unless you sidehop or jumpslash etc.

The reason for this working is that in vanilla OoT, both the second and main room have the poe/torch on the obj list for both rooms, for MQ, the second room doesn't have which completely removes the actor once another room has been loaded.
However, you can apply the stun to Gohma by throwing a Deku Nut or using Slingshot to shoot Deku Seeds at Gohma's position before the cutscene starts.
The position of the Deku Nut or Deku Seeds will be paused once the cutscene starts, and once the cutscene ends Gohma will get an immediate stun.
I truly doubt this will be any faster to do for console, if it is worth doing for a TAS, it'd only be worth doing for 100%/Child Max% with the Slingshot method because:
1. For the Deku Nut Method, you have to actually get closer to where Gohma's position usually starts for when the fight actually begins, which you are wasting a lot of time doing to prepare for.
2. Usually for a full game TAS, there is no category where you would actually obtain the Slingshot except for 100%/Child Max% (I think is the only 2), it's a big maybe that it can be used for those categories for a TAS only if it is actually faster.
Timing for both fights starting from when I could gain control over Link, and ending when I had no control over him.
Slingshot Method: 1.12 Seconds
Deku Nut Method: 1.15 Seconds
For some odd reason with the Deku Nut Method, the first frame I tried crouch stabbing, gohma still had the invincibility frames for an additional frame, Idk if there was a way to improve it or not, I don't think it really matters anyways since the Deku Nut method is actually a useless strat anyways.
